Unlocking the Value of Scotland’s Public Sector Data

The Unlocking the Value of Data programme aims to unlock the value of Scotland’s public sector personal data - when used with or by the private sector - to deliver benefits for Scotland.

The Scottish public sector has rich data sets that, if made available in trustworthy, ethical ways, can provide opportunities for the private sector to use personal data innovatively to realise social and economic value.

Under the direction of an Independent Expert Group, chaired by Professor Angela Daly of Dundee University, the programme will develop high-level principles and guidance that Scottish public bodies can adopt and operationalise within their respective sectors.

The aim of this guidance will be to enable ethical, lawful, and confident decision-making by public sector data controllers for this type of data use.

These outputs will be co-produced with stakeholders, including the public, industry, third sector, civil society organisations, and practitioners who hold and/or seek access to data in the public interest.

The direct participation of the public will be essential in shaping this work. Involving the public in decision-making about data governance is fundamental to addressing legitimate concerns about how personal data is used and to embedding best practice that will command public trust and confidence.
